Step into a lush oasis tucked away within the heart of Tel Aviv’s largest park. This serene sanctuary is home to the Council for a Beautiful Israel (CBI), a beacon for environmental awareness and action. This unique organization has dedicated its existence to fostering a greener, healthier, and more beautiful Israel for all. Established in 1968 by the Interior Committee of the Knesset, the CBI has played a vital role in shaping the environmental landscape of the country.

The council’s vision, beautifying Israel’s environment, is reflected in its mission of promoting progress in the quality of life, encouraging citizens to take active responsibility for their surroundings. The CBI has a strong presence throughout Israel, with 11 branches operating across the country, mobilizing communities from the north to the south. Their work has spanned decades, encompassing various projects aimed at safeguarding the environment and fostering environmental awareness among the public.

One of their notable accomplishments is the creation of the ‘Outlook’ Visitors’ Center in Tel Aviv’s Yarkon Park. This center is unique, not only in the country but also in the world. It offers a captivating experience, highlighting the richness and complexity of environmental challenges and the ways in which individuals and communities are addressing them in the modern age. Their field activities include the transformation of urban spaces, including parks, playgrounds, and urban complexes, transforming neglected areas into vibrant public spaces that benefit the local communities.

Today, the CBI stands as a testament to the power of collective action in safeguarding the environment. Its legacy is visible throughout Israel, inspiring generations to commit to a greener future.
